How to Improve Your Gaming Skills: Tips and Strategies

In today’s digital world, gaming has become a popular pastime for many people of all ages. Whether you’re playing on a console, PC, or mobile device, the competition can be tough, and it’s important to work on constantly improving your gaming skills to stay ahead of the game. In this article, we’ll discuss some tips and strategies you can use to take your gaming to the next level.

1. Practice, Practice, Practice

The old saying “practice makes perfect” holds true for gaming as well. The more you play a game, the better you will get at it. Spend time practicing on your own, and try to progress in difficulty levels as you feel more confident in your skills. Also, don’t shy away from playing with others as playing with different people can provide a fresh new perspective on the game and can also help you understand other players’ strategies.

2. Learn the Controls

Knowing the controls of the game is key when it comes to improving your gaming skills. Spend some time getting familiar with the controls and understanding what each one does. This way, you can react quickly to different situations in the game, and you can make the most of your time playing.

3. Focus on One Game at a Time

Focusing on one game at a time is another great way to improve your gaming skills. By focusing on one game, you can familiarize yourself with the mechanics, controls, and strategies of that game. This will make it easier to progress through levels and become a better player overall.

4. Watch and Learn from Others

Watching and learning from others can also be a great way to improve your gaming skills. There are many tutorials, walkthroughs, and live streams available online that can help you learn new strategies and techniques. Watching professional players play can also teach you how to handle different situations and scenarios that may come up in the game.

5. Get Comfortable with Your Gear

It’s essential to get comfortable with the gaming gear you’re using, whether it is a controller or a keyboard and mouse. Make sure the settings and controls are in sync with what you are comfortable with. If your gear does not suit your preferences, it can hinder your gameplay and affect your performance.

6. Take Breaks

Gaming can be a great stress reliever, but it’s also essential to take breaks for both your physical and mental health. Taking breaks can help you avoid burnout and prevent fatigue, which can affect your performance. So, it’s essential to take regular breaks to stretch, refill your energy and take a fresh breath of air.
